Conflict in relationships rarely begins with disagreement. It begins when perspective disappears. Each person experiences the same situation through different mental filters shaped by past experiences, beliefs, and emotions. When those perspectives are ignored, conversations quickly shift from understanding to defending. In psychology, this is often linked to egocentric bias and defensive communication. Instead of focusing on the issue, partners begin protecting their own viewpoint, which turns a problem into a personal battle. But when people pause long enough to understand how the other person is interpreting the situation, something important happens. Empathy increases. Defensiveness lowers. The conversation moves from winning to understanding. Healthy relationships are not defined by the absence of conflict. They are defined by the ability to hold two perspectives at once and still choose connection. Perspective doesn’t erase disagreement. It simply prevents disagreement from becoming disconnection. You don’t get to hurt someone and then make their reaction the main issue. (This does not apply to abusive reactions.) What is wrong with the interaction shown in the video? It’s that the original harm never gets addressed. Instead, responsibility gets shifted to how the other person reacted. Yes, reactions matter. But repair doesn’t start there. Healthy repair looks like: • Acknowledging the hurt you caused • Taking responsibility without defensiveness • Then (and only then) talking about how the conflict escalated When you skip accountability and jump straight to ā€œbut your reaction hurt me too,ā€ you invalidate the pain and shut down resolution. And that’s why people eventually stop trying to tell you what you did wrong. Not because they don’t care, but because the conversation isn’t emotionally safe anymore. . . . . . . . . . . Dalam psikologi hubungan, tidak adanya relasi yang sempurna berkaitan dengan realistic expectations dan ego regulation. Setiap individu membawa luka, kebiasaan, dan kebutuhan emosional masing-masing ke dalam hubungan. Konflik bukan tanda kegagalan, melainkan konsekuensi alami dari dua sistem psikologis yang berbeda yang saling berinteraksi. Hubungan yang bertahan beririsan dengan humility, emotional maturity, dan conflict resolution. Menurunkan ego berarti bersedia mendengar tanpa defensif, mengakui kesalahan tanpa merasa direndahkan, dan memilih memahami daripada menang. Saat ego diturunkan, sistem emosional menjadi lebih fleksibel, sehingga hubungan bergerak ke arah kerja sama, bukan pertarungan kekuasaan. Penelitian menunjukkan bahwa kualitas hubungan jangka panjang lebih dipengaruhi oleh kemampuan mengelola ego dan emosi dibanding kecocokan sempurna. Dua orang yang mau saling menyesuaikan, belajar, dan merendahkan diri akan membangun ikatan yang lebih aman dan tahan uji. Hubungan bertahan bukan karena minim konflik, tetapi karena kedewasaan dalam menyikapinya. Referensi: Gottman, J. — The Science of Trust and Relationships Rogers, C. — Empathy and Unconditional Positive Regard Aron, A. — Self-Expansion in Close Relationships APA — Healthy Relationships and Conflict Resolution

→ 1: Your communication styles never aligned no matter how much you both tried… One person needs words, the other needs space. When basic communication is incompatible, every conflict becomes unsolvable. → 2: Life priorities were in completely different order… Maybe she wanted marriage and kids within 2 years, maybe you wanted career first. Or you valued stability, she valued adventure. No compromise exists when core values oppose each other. → 3: Conflict resolution patterns were opposites… You wanted immediate resolution, she wanted time to process. Or you wanted to talk it out, she shut down completely. These patterns don’t change, they just create permanent friction. → 4: Energy levels and social needs never matched… One person’s ideal night is the other person’s nightmare. Long term resentment builds when rest looks different for both people. → 5: Emotional depth requirements were mismatched… You craved deep conversations, but that wasn’t her thing. Or she needed constant emotional connection, you needed quality over quantity time. Neither person is wrong, both are just wired differently. Incompatibility is biological and psychological mismatch, not failure. But most guys blame themselves when the relationship was structurally impossible from the start.
